Add EKS Secret envelope encryption support (#772)

This adds support for configuring EKS clusters that utilise envelope
encryption for Secrets:

terraform {
required_version = ">= 0.12.0"
}
provider "aws" {
version = ">= 2.52.0"
region = var.region
}
provider "random" {
version = "~> 2.1"
}
provider "local" {
version = "~> 1.2"
}
provider "null" {
version = "~> 2.1"
}
provider "template" {
version = "~> 2.1"
}
data "aws_eks_cluster" "cluster" {
name = module.eks.cluster_id
}
data "aws_eks_cluster_auth" "cluster" {
name = module.eks.cluster_id
}
provider "kubernetes" {
host = data.aws_eks_cluster.cluster.endpoint
cluster_ca_certificate = base64decode(data.aws_eks_cluster.cluster.certificate_authority.0.data)
token = data.aws_eks_cluster_auth.cluster.token
load_config_file = false
version = "1.10"
}
data "aws_availability_zones" "available" {
}
locals {
cluster_name = "test-eks-${random_string.suffix.result}"
}
resource "random_string" "suffix" {
length = 8
special = false
}
resource "aws_kms_key" "eks" {
description = "EKS Secret Encryption Key"
}
module "vpc" {
source = "terraform-aws-modules/vpc/aws"
version = "2.6.0"
name = "test-vpc"
cidr = "10.0.0.0/16"
azs = data.aws_availability_zones.available.names
private_subnets = ["10.0.1.0/24", "10.0.2.0/24", "10.0.3.0/24"]
public_subnets = ["10.0.4.0/24", "10.0.5.0/24", "10.0.6.0/24"]
enable_nat_gateway = true
single_nat_gateway = true
enable_dns_hostnames = true
tags = {
"kubernetes.io/cluster/${local.cluster_name}" = "shared"
}
public_subnet_tags = {
"kubernetes.io/cluster/${local.cluster_name}" = "shared"
"kubernetes.io/role/elb" = "1"
}
private_subnet_tags = {
"kubernetes.io/cluster/${local.cluster_name}" = "shared"
"kubernetes.io/role/internal-elb" = "1"
}
}
module "eks" {
source = "../.."
cluster_name = local.cluster_name
subnets = module.vpc.private_subnets
cluster_encryption_config = [
{
provider_key_arn = aws_kms_key.eks.arn
resources = ["secrets"]
}
]
tags = {
Environment = "test"
GithubRepo = "terraform-aws-eks"
GithubOrg = "terraform-aws-modules"
}
vpc_id = module.vpc.vpc_id
worker_groups = [
{
name = "worker-group-1"
instance_type = "t2.small"
additional_userdata = "echo foo bar"
asg_desired_capacity = 2
},
]
map_roles = var.map_roles
map_users = var.map_users
map_accounts = var.map_accounts
}
